    Family-Friendly Features: Choosing a Pool for Traditional Recreation

    For families who prefer more traditional forms of water recreation, a swimming pool might be the better option. Pools provide more space for activities, such as pool parties, cannonballs, and games like water volleyball. They also often have shallow areas for younger children to play safely. It’s important to consider the types of activities you enjoy when deciding between a pool and swim spa.

    Maintenance and Cost Savings: Swim Spa vs. Pool Options

    Another vital factor to consider when deciding between a swim spa and a pool is the ongoing maintenance costs. A swim spa requires less maintenance than a traditional pool since it is smaller in size and has fewer parts that require maintenance. Swim spas also require less water and lower chemical usage, contributing to overall cost savings. However, it’s essential to consider how much use you’ll get out of your swim spa or pool before making a purchase decision.

    Health and Wellness: How a Swim Spa Can Improve Your Life

    Swim spas offer a wide range of health benefits that make them an excellent option for individuals looking to improve their quality of life. They are an ideal option for low-impact exercise, making them perfect for seniors or individuals recovering from an injury. Swim spas are also great for hydrotherapy as they provide a perfect environment for water aerobics, stretching, and other forms of therapy. Overall, the use of swim spas has been proven to provide improved circulation, stress relief, and muscle relaxation.
